Research Accounts Administrator UCD are recruiting for a Research Accounts Administrator to assist in the financial administration of all university research activity in the Research Finance Office. **Job Summary** We are seeking a highly organized and detail-oriented individual to manage the financial aspects of research activity, ensuring accurate and timely preparation of cost statements and grant claim forms. **Key Responsibilities** * Prepare or assist in the preparation of cost statements and grant claim forms * Submit all cost statements and grant claim forms on a timely basis * Assist in the preparation of research-funded VAT returns * Check project account budgets against student/staff appointments to projects * Deal with queries from researchers and funding bodies concerning research activity * Monitor expenditure on the university's research accounts * Liaise with funding bodies regarding financial aspects of funded research projects * Assist in the preparation of year-end audit files * Provide an advisory service to researchers in respect of contract administration * Assist with the development, implementation and maintenance of research accounting procedures * Provide accounting support to academic staff under the supervision of the Head of Office or designate **Requirements** * Experience in accounting/book-keeping * Excellent interpersonal and communication skills, both written and oral * Demonstrate administrative and organisational ability, including the ability to manage competing priorities * Excellent computer skills, including word processing, spreadsheets, Internet and e-mail * Ability to work to deadlines and to take decisions * Prior experience of working in a role requiring discretion when handling confidential information * Ability to work on own initiative and as part of a team * Proven ability to prioritise work * High level of accuracy and attention to detail * Previous experience of working in a busy and demanding office environment **Desirable Criteria** * Experience in accounting for funded research * Pursuing a professional accountancy qualification * Knowledge of VAT issues relating to funded research * Understanding of the audit process * Experience of University accounting system (eFinancials)
